World Youth Chess Championships 2014 – Winners

The 2014 FIDE World Youth Chess Championships were held on 18-30th September at the International Convention Centre, Durban, Kwa-Zulu Natal, South Africa.

The event was organized by the South African Chess Federation under the auspices of FIDE.

India is boasting six individual medals – 2 gold, 2 silver and 2 bronze, while representatives of Russia have won one of each medal.

Seven countries are having two medals each: Vietnam, Mongolia and Kazakhstan with one gold and one silver; China and USA with one gold and one bronze; Belarus and Iran with one silver and one bronze each.

Among the other countries, Canada, Slovenia, Argentina and Ukraine have one gold medal each.

Greece, Germany, Uzbekistan and Poland are with one silver medal each.

Closing the count, Chile, Turkmenistan, Romania, Slovakia and France are with one bronze medal each.

List of medal winners is below.

FIDE World Youth Chess Championships 2014

U18 boys:
1 IM Bortnyk Olexandr UKR 2505 – 9.5
2 GM Vaibhav Suri IND 2521 – 9.0
3 IM Henriquez Villagra Cristobal CHI 2466 – 7.5

U18 girls:
1 WGM Saduakassova Dinara KAZ 2409 – 10.0
2 WIM Osmanodja Filiz GER 2310 – 8.5
3 WFM Xiao Yiyi CHN 2168 – 8.0

U16 boys:
1 IM Pichot Alan ARG 2452 – 9.0
2 IM Aravindh Chithambaram Vr. IND 2496 – 8.5
3 FM Bellahcene Bilel FRA 2428 – 8.5

U16 girls:
1 WFM Unuk Laura SLO 2247 – 9.0
2 WFM Tsolakidou Stavroula GRE 2250 – 8.5
3 WFM Gazikova Veronika SVK 2134 – 8.0

U14 boys:
1 Liu Yan CHN 2364 – 9.5
2 FM Tabatabaei M.Amin IRI 2326 – 8.5
3 FM Costachi Mihnea ROU 2356 – 8.5

U14 girls:
1 WFM Zhou Qiyu CAN 2119 – 8.5
2 WFM Kiolbasa Oliwia POL 2094 – 8.5
3 WFM Vaishali Ramesh Babu IND 2124 – 8.0

U12 boys:
1 FM Nguyen Anh Khoi VIE 2208 – 8.5
2 Zarubitski Viachaslau BLR 2130 – 8.5
3 Taghizadeh Rayan USA 2026 – 8.5

U12 girls:
1 WFM Yu Jennifer R USA 2043 – 10.0
2 WFM Solozhenkina Elizaveta RUS 1946 – 8.0
3 Badelka Olga BLR 2091 – 8.0

U10 boys:
1 Nihal Sarin IND 2018 – 9.0
2 FM Abdusattorov Nodirbek UZB 2128 – 8.5
3 Tsoi Dmitry RUS 2027 – 8.5

U10 girls:
1 WFM Divya Deshmukh IND 1607 – 10.0
2 WFM Assaubayeva Bibissara KAZ 1927 – 10.0
3 WFM Asadi Motahare IRI 1726 – 8.0

U8 boys:
1 Makoveev Ilya RUS 1799 – 9.5
2 CM Tugstumur Yesuntumur MGL 1612 – 9.5
3 CM Mendonca Leon Luke IND 1465 – 8.0

U8 girls:
1 Davaakhuu Munkhzul MGL – 8.5
2 Luu Ha Bich Ngoc VIE – 8.5
3 Ezizova Bagul TKM – 8.0
